| Hello, I am desperate need of help. I am so new to Photoshop and I am creating buttons, but have looked and looked and I am frustrated that I cannot find out how to erase the background (white or grey or transparent) so I can then just save the button as a .*Jpeg and then import it where I need to (w/out all that white space). I can't believe i have searched all over found nothing (5 hours)It should be something so simple, yet I can't find it. Please help me! Thanks. | | | | | |

| | I am not quike catch you either, so I suppose that you want to get button with transparent backgound. If you have drawn a button on the background layer, and you want to delete the colors around the button, I think you should first unlock the background layer, and then make the places you want to delete selected, and press the "delete" button on your keyboard. If you have drawn the button on a new layer, you just need to delete the background layer directly, and you will get what you want. | | | | | | |

| | If you made it yourself, delete the layer with the background, or if you were so smart to do everything on one layer, select the background using the magic wand, press delete (twice if needed), and export it to PNG or GIF. Exporting it to JPEG is not a good idea with buttons, since JPEG adds automatically a white background. If you downloaded the button and want to remove the background, select the background using the magic wand, press delete and export it to PNG or GIF. I hope this was helpful ^^ | | | | | | |
